example for writing file in looping luarpc

stm32.enc.init(3) | |
stm32.enc.setidxtrig(cpu.INT_GPIO_POSEDGE, pio.PB_5, 3, 32768) | |
local state = {} | |
local stime | |
cycletime = 20000 | |
tdiff = 0 | |
function control() | |
end | |
iter = 1 | |
handle = rpc.listen(0,0) | |
stime = tmr.start(tmr.SYS_TIMER) | |
while true do | |
-- Check for pending RPC request | |
if rpc.peek( handle ) then | |
rpc.dispatch( handle ) | |
end | |
control() | |
tdiff = tmr.gettimediff( tmr.SYS_TIMER, stime, tmr.read(tmr.SYS_TIMER) ) | |
tmr.delay( 1, cycletime - (tmr.read(tmr.SYS_TIMER) % cycletime ) ) | |
stime = tmr.read(tmr.SYS_TIMER) | |
iter = iter+1 | |
end |

function error_handler (message) | |
io.write ("MY ERROR: " .. message .. "\n"); | |
end | |
rpc.on_error (error_handler); | |
slave,err = rpc.connect ("/dev/tty.usbserial-FTDXSDBS"); | |
state_init = {fd = nil, fname='/mmc/testfile4.txt', iter = 1} | |
function control_open_write() | |
if state.fd == nil then | |
state.fd = io.open(state.fname, "w+") | |
else | |
state.fd:write(string.format("%d, %d\n", state.iter, tdiff)) | |
state.fd:flush() | |
end | |
state.iter = state.iter+1 | |
end | |
function control_close() | |
if state.fd ~= nil then | |
state.fd:flush() | |
state.fd:close() | |
state.fd = nil | |
end | |
end | |
slave.state = state_init | |
slave.control = control_open_write | |
-- wait for some time to pass, then close with | |
slave.control = control_close |
